Basketmouth Announces End Of His 12-year-old Marriage To Wife Elsie

The wave of marriage crash rocking the Nigerian entertainment scene has hit the home of popular Nigerian comedian, Bright Okpocha a.k.a Basketmouth, as he announced that his marriage has crashed.

Basketmouth and his wife, Elsie, have decided to end their relationship in what looked like a mutual divorce after they had explored all options to resolve their differences.

The comedian in a post on Instagram confirmed that he and his wife have decided to end their marriage even as he said he regretted bringing his private life to the social media platforms.

According to Basketmouth, after much deliberations, they came to the painful conclusion to part ways while urging the public to respect their privacy at this moment.

“As we move on separately, we will continue to work together to give our beautiful children all the care, love, guidance and support they need.

“We humbly ask that you respect our privacy as we navigate through these times,” he said.

Basketmouth and Elsie Uzoma Okpocha tied the knot in 2010. They have three children together, Janelle, Jason, and Maya Okpocha.
